Born in Honolulu (Hawaii) in 1968, Taylor Wily was of Samoan descent. Her birth name was Teila Tuli.Wily’s manager, Michael Henderson, told USA TODAY publicly that Wily had died of “natural causes”. At the time of writing, no further information is available.Paul Almond, her lawyer, confirmed this information, but did not specify the reason or place of death. Hawaii Five-0 executive producer Peter Lenkov posted a comment on Instagram reading, “Devastated. Heartbroken. I’ll post detailed feelings in a few days. It’s too hard right now.”
